Otherwise, its easy for a codebase to get out of hand with lots of inconsistencies between each developers individual choices. Run one of the following commands to install the package: Import the component, hook, or utility that you want to use in your Hydrogen app. I spend time with my family. Hydrogen is built with React. sign in They then built a product page for sold out items, and soon plan to build out all of their product pages in Hydrogen. */ { resolve: "gatsby-source-shopify-multi-language", options: { // The domain name of your . Described as a "Framework for Dynamic Commerce", using Shopify's Hydrogen gives you the ability to build and deliver fast, personalized shopping experiences. If that value is not set the plugin will source only objects that are published to the online store sales channel. This is in the format of my-unique-store-name.myshopify.com. Dynamic by Default: Shopify's Hydrogen, a New Take on React Demo store Shopify / hydrogen Public 2023-01 The additional arguments enable internationalization (i18n), caching, and other features particular to Remix and Oxygen. I am wondering if there are any patterns y'all like for "reusable GROQ query strings" currently I am calling this query (or one very similar) in about 3 different places in my nextjs app. This repository has been archived by the owner on Mar 3, 2023. Visit our Engineering career page to find out about our open positions and learn about Digital by Design. Let your customers know that they can pay with Alma! Going headless with SimiCart today. The initial version was made available on November 6, 2021, and the framework has been improved numerous times. Learn more about Shopify. are all available when using Gatsby and Shopify. Shopify APIs and SDKs Using GraphQL Admin API with GatsbyJS Using GraphQL Admin API with GatsbyJS iamskok New Member 5 0 0 05-12-2019 12:46 AM Summary I'm working on sourcing and combining data from Shopify Storefront and GraphQL Admin APIs into Gatsby. To add dynamic functionality we need to add and integrate shopify-buy SDK. hydrogen-react has become a sub-package in the Hydrogen monorepo. A runtime utility for serverless environments. But Hydrogen is still a relatively new technology and all the capabilities provided by Hydrogen are also available with other JavaScript frameworks, such as Next.js, which have larger developer communities. You signed in with another tab or window. But Id encourage you to give it a shot within the context of a Hydrogen storefront, because I think Tailwind and Hydrogen make for a good combination. Insights. Both ensure that your storefront will respond quickly to users while also ensuring that the latest data is available to them. Begin developing a Hydrogen storefront | Hydrogen v1 This field will be re-added once the bug has been fixed on the Shopify side. We think the future of commerce on the web is fast, personal, and dynamicand Hydrogen reflects how we see that vision coming to life. Shopify Plus customers can select Hydrogen when creating a new sales channel and deploy to Oxygen with relative ease. Import createStorefrontClient() and add the private access token to the helper function. yarn create @shopify/hydrogen. And I dont need to double check that my other hundred components adhere to the same convention since Tailwind enforces it for me. The Inspiration Company also started using POS Go, Shopify's handheld POS terminal that enables its staff to serve customers and accept payments anywhere on the sales floor.Its integrated bar code scanner and card reader make the checkout experience feel frictionless for customers and staff, who no longer need to juggle an iPad and Bluetooth card reader to close sales. Frameworks such as Nextjs added the ability to render components on the server. It expects an image object that contains the properties width, height and originalSrc, such as a Storefront API Image object. This additional functionality allows you to build a memorable and distinctive store from the ground up. The customer wants a new landing page but with the old theme/shop, is it possible to combine Hydrogen with the old Shopify theme? They have autocomplete search, logical grouping of CSS topics, and lots of examples. They selected Hydrogen so their development team could take advantage of the built-in commerce components, hooks, and utilities that would speed time to market. This allows the plugin to pause non-priority builds while priority builds are running while using the same Shopify App. It represents a navigation that should be hidden at small breakpoints but displayed at larger breakpoints (hidden lg:block). Hydrogen Headless CMS - Hygraph, Shopify, and Hydrogen More design freedom. Scaling your website is also much easier as the server is no longer responsible for handling every page request. Next.js allows developers to build anything from headless storefronts to social media applications. Combine content and data from Shopify, WordPress, Contentful, and other web services in one unified experience. Demo Store template. The Gatsby Framework and Cloud are built from the ground-up to deliver the fastest possible experience to end users. Mobile-first and super-fast e-commerce website; Gets you more organic traffic because of Google rewards high-performance website; Increase your conversion rate by . A platform contains both software and hardware, which provides an environment for people to create and use its application. No need to use tools and technology on separate domains or subdomains - unlock the full potential of the web with headless e-commerce. But there are a few potential drawbacks that you should consider. Gatsby has 2500+ plugins to help make your next e-commerce store a success. This means that if you're building a Hydrogen app, then you should import them from the @shopify/hydrogen package. For the Private app name enter Gatsby (the name does not really matter). This makes for a more brittle system. Here is a direct link to the source code: https://github.com/Shopify/hydrogen/tree/main/packages/hydrogen-react. In this article, well introduce Hydrogen by describing what it does, what types of problems it solves for brands, and how it compares with other JavaScript frameworks, such as Next.js and Gatsby. At Shopify Unite 2021, we shared a preview of Hydrogen, a React-based framework for building custom storefronts powered by Shopify. Gatsby can be employed to create marketing and content sites as well as ecommerce storefronts. So youre off and running with Hydrogen and Tailwind, but maybe one thing is rubbing you the wrong way: why are there so many CSS classes? Static-site generated e-commerce stores can have a dramatic impact on page load speed, time to first paint, and other user experience metrics Google measures in their recent Core Web Vitals update. The longer that Oxygen has not yet been live, and will be available by the end of 2022. Hydrogen components, hooks, and utilities overview - Shopify Bring the best parts of Hydrogen to more React frameworks, like Next.js and Gatsby, and accelerate headless development using Shopifys pre-built React components including Cart, Shop Pay, and Shopify Analytics. Interaction events that expects a response from an API endpoint are often implemented with Remix's actions. Introduced with React 18, however, React Server Components now allow developers to select rendering on the server or client at the component level. If you followed the tutorial for adding an item to cart, your add to cart button makes a request to the cart action. Integrate Storybook with Shopify's Hydrogen | We Make Websites This means that any queries for metafields on a specific Shopify Owner Resource, need to be replaced like so: This will produce an equivalent to the previous example: Due to a bug with the Shopify API legacy locations throw an error internally in the Shopify API, ShopifyLocation.fulfillmentService.callbackUrl has been removed. Shopifys Liquid themes employ a monolith tech stack, using server resources on each page render, which can slow down page loading speed when optimizing the site for personalization or handling increased traffic during flash sales. Hydrogen: Shopify's headless commerce framework The CacheLong strategy instructs caches to store data for 1 hour, and staleWhileRevalidate data for an additional 23 hours. We're happy to see Shopify, like Shogun, embracing React.js as the future of performant ecommerce storefronts. Shopify Hydrogen is a new React framework that allows developers to create genuinely unique custom Shopify storefronts. Determines if the error is resulted from a Storefront API call. When the navigation links are hovered, their opacity changes to 80% (hover:opacity-80). Create a Hydrogen app locally to begin developing a Hydrogen storefront. Ahh, p-4 should do the trick. 4. As such, Shopify storefronts launched on Liquid need to be rebuilt using Hydrogen. What is Shopify Hydrogen? - Ecommerce Platforms This query is commonly used on collection pages to only load necessary image data. With headless Shopify and Gatsby, build amazing websites that are easy to customize, load in milliseconds, and delight every visitor. Explore the official documentation or view the repo to get started with your next Hydrogen project. Once the web page is delivered to the users browser, the JavaScript can make additional API calls to request more data. Create over $50,000 in value for yourself or your clients! The agency created a unique storefront with a homepage collage, an abstract product landing page grid, and a component that would archive collections. Redirect traffic to the Hydrogen storefront, Anchor link to section titled "Hydrogen tutorial series", Anchor link to section titled "More resources". Use these to fine-tune cache performance when hosting your Hydrogen app on Oxygen. Hooks, however, are not available for use outside of Hydrogen, although your developers can certainly code them from scratch in Next.js. Previously, the following metafield types used to exist: These have now been combined into a single ShopifyMetafield type. Jamstack is a modern approach to web development based on Javascript, APIs, and Markup (JAM). There are 10 other projects in the npm registry using @shopify/hydrogen. They are incrementally transitioning their Liquid site to Hydrogen by first building a store locator feature, which they were able to build in 3 weeks given Hydrogens built-in commerce components and hooks. TTFB is critical for SEO, as Google uses this metric as a ranking factor. Returns the fully qualified URL to your shop domain. mynameisadamf. When I use Tailwind, I dont have to use that time naming things. Hydrogen provides a selection of built-in caching strategies. Florian Dupuis on LinkedIn: The Fastest Frontend for the Headless Web Intrigued? Selecting Hydrogen as your framework further enmeshes your tech stack into Shopifys ecosystem. Shopify Buy SDK (Dynamic Functionality) Using the gatsby-source-shopify we have successfully built our product pages. Fastest way to deploy Hydrogen storefronts Globally distributed hosting for performant storefronts worldwide Worry-free uptime, security, and maintenance Extend your build Integrate with apps and platforms to enhance what your Hydrogen storefront can do. I didnt even find an adequate place to mention the fact that Tailwind allows you to use dark mode out of the box! Hydrogen contains a set of Shopify-specific commerce components, hooks, and utilities that help accelerate your development process. An object overriding the default strategy values. Hydrogen - The Shopify stack for headless commerce | Shopify App Store Whether you sell ten products or ten thousand products, Gatsby sites are fast, scalable, and secure. Pros/benefits of using Gatsby and Shopify. The function to run a mutation on storefront api. This allows you to create your own caching strategy, using any of the options available in a CachingStrategy object. One of the ways we collaborate internally is with our API team that constantly improves the Storefront API based on feedback from the community. Announced at Unite in 2021, Shopify Hydrogen is a React-based framework or set of developer tools for building custom Shopify storefronts that are more personalized and performant. Although it made the plugin easier to interact with, it made it impossible to add videos or 3D renderings to your products. The commerce platform powering millions of businesses worldwide. The most advanced template comes with Shopify-specific commerce components that reduces the time your developers spend on building your storefront. Today, we are excited to share that Hydrogen is now available in developer preview! Accepted values: 'orders', 'collections', 'locations'. @Serafeim It's similar to next.js or gatsby so you can use any tuts about that as a jumping off point of the concepts.
Sugar Solution Density Calculator, Midtown Tennis Club Closing, Abortion Clinic Peoria, Il, Macquarie Bank Hierarchy, Kappa Alpha Psi Founders Were Masons, Articles S